Motorcycle Maintenance: What Are Common Motorcycle Maintenance Mistakes?
Motorcycle maintenance is crucial for ensuring safety, performance, and longevity of your bike. However, many riders make common mistakes that can lead to serious issues. Understanding these pitfalls can save time, money, and potentially your life.
One of the most frequent errors is neglecting regular oil changes. Oil acts as the lifeblood of your motorcycle, keeping the engine lubricated and preventing overheating. Failing to change the oil at recommended intervals can lead to engine wear and tear. To avoid this mistake, always refer to your owner’s manual for specific guidelines. Another common oversight is ignoring tire care. Tires are the only point of contact between your bike and the road, making their condition paramount. Many riders forget to check tire pressure regularly or fail to inspect for tread wear. Under-inflated tires can lead to poor handling and increased stopping distances. Brakes are another critical component that often gets overlooked. Riders may fail to inspect brake pads and fluid levels, assuming they will last indefinitely. Worn brake pads can severely compromise stopping power, leading to dangerous situations. Regularly inspect your brakes and replace pads as needed. Chain maintenance is also a key aspect of motorcycle upkeep. A poorly maintained chain can lead to inefficiencies and increased wear on other components. Riders often neglect to lubricate or adjust the chain tension, which can cause it to wear out prematurely. Regular cleaning and lubrication of the chain can extend its life and improve ride quality.
Another common mistake is overlooking electrical systems. Many riders fail to check battery connections or the condition of wires. Corrosion or loose connections can lead to starting issues or electrical failures. Regularly inspect the battery, clean terminals, and ensure that all wires are secure to prevent unexpected problems.
Cleaning your motorcycle is often seen as a cosmetic task, but neglecting this can lead to more significant issues. Dirt and grime can accumulate in critical areas, leading to corrosion and reducing the lifespan of components. Establishing a regular cleaning routine not only keeps your bike looking great but also helps maintain its performance.
Many riders also make the mistake of ignoring the importance of storage. Leaving a motorcycle exposed to the elements can cause rust and deterioration of parts. If you cannot store your bike in a garage, consider investing in a quality cover that will protect it from the weather.
Finally, one of the most significant errors is not consulting the owner’s manual. Each motorcycle is unique, and the manual provides crucial information on maintenance schedules, recommended products, and specific checks needed for your model. Skipping this step can lead to overlooking vital maintenance areas.
